Minus The Bear's Planet of Ice set for September release
Mike_Diver by Mike Diver July 19th, 2007

Seattle-based alterna-indie quintet Minus The Bear are to release their third long-player proper on September 10, through Undergroove.

The follow-up to 2005's well-received Menos El Oso was recorded by former band member Matt Bayles in Seattle; Bayles' keyboard position has been filled by Alex Rose.

Having had the record on in the office a couple of times lately, DiS can report that it is good. A massive departure from previous material? Maybe... there's certainly a greater electronica edge to it than albums past.
